The following table shows how many telephone numbers you can store in the
machine.

Quick Dials

30

Speed Dials

100

Ten Key Pad (

1)

67

Groups (

2)

7

1 This is the number of full telephone numbers that can be input into the

machine at any one time. For example, if there is a broadcasting operation in
memory using 66 full numbers, you can only input one more full number for
any operation, including storage in groups, until the broadcast has finished.
Also, if you have stored, say, 30 numbers at the ten key pad into your groups,
then you will only be able to input 37 full dial numbers at any one time for
other operations, such as broadcasting.

2 You can program up to 7 groups. Each group can contain up to 132 numbers.

You can store any Quick Dial or Speed Dial number in a group. You may also
store up to 67 numbers that are not programmed as Quick or Speed Dials;
see Note 1 above for the restrictions on the use of these numbers.

3 This is the theoretical maximum number of pages that can be stored.
